One of Queenscliff's most primely positioned properties, charming in street appeal yet grand in proportion, this beautifully maintained double fronted period home offers a floorplan that will surprise and delight. Located directly between Hesse Street and bay front Citizens Park, an envied lifestyle awaits!

Currently run as holiday accommodation, the classic cottage with its street front verandah offers spacious 4 bedroom accommodation, a pleasant surprise considering the age of the home. 4 original fireplaces offer that quality period charm amongst many other features of the era providing true history and character. The majority of these features are found in the formal living room with its original brick fireplace and pressed metal ceilings soaring above. A separate open plan living space at the rear of the home faces north allowing alfresco living to flow easily between the sun filled deck and brand new kitchen. Although modern in design and housed within a recent extension, this addition compliments the white interior of the traditional home. Quality stainless appliances and stone look benchtops compliment the subtle grey cabinets which incorporate a European style laundry with direct access to a central decked courtyard, housing the clothesline separately to the main alfresco area. A further verandah wraps the western edge of the property providing a pleasant outlook from bay windows of one of the bedrooms inside.

All 4 bedrooms are generous (2 with their own appealing fireplaces) allowing spacious accommodation for up to 9 guests. The charming bathrooms also make the home comfortable either holiday let or permanent living, their traditional black and white tiling retaining an original decor scheme in a timeless design with all the modern comforts one would desire. The larger of the two bathrooms offers a large shower, plenty of storage within the vanity, WC and beautiful original fireplace, while the smaller provides a separate toilet, and a shower over a small bath, ideal for young children.

Despite the multiple historic fireplaces, climate control is taken care of in a modern fashion; reverse cycle split system to the rear living section, plus gas heating and air conditioning located in other rooms allows for instant and easy control.

The location is what affords this home its busy holiday rental appeal, only a mere 50m stroll to either water front parkland or the bustling cafes, restaurants and galleries, commercial zoning provides an opportunity for permanent commercial let or live in office space as an option also.

Off street parking for 1 car is provided with gated entry to the private and secure rear yard.

Fletchers Area Guide Queenscliff, VIC 3225

Situated on Bellarine Peninsula and the entrance to Port Phillip Bay, Queenscliff's first residents came in the 1850s. The settlement received a fillip 20 years later when a rail service connected the town to Geelong. Today, that rail service only runs 16 km from Drysdale - now as a tourist attraction. The Bellarine Rail Trail is a walking and cycling track that largely follows the railway line. Historical buildings abound in and around Queenscliff's commercial centre.
